Как проверить что параметр выгружается в фиде.

Как проверить заявку с жалобой на отсутствие на площадке необходимого параметра.

 

Если приходит жалоба от клиента о том, что параметр не выгружается в фид, нужно проверить ВСЕ пункты данной инструкции.


1. Например, поступила жалоба, что не выгружается параметр Материал стен с тегом Walls Type на Авито.

Перед тем как искать параметр в фиде, нужно  зайти в требования площадки, и убедится, что название параметра соответствует тому, что вы ищете в заданной категории и типе сделки.

 

Далее, сотрудник ТП должен найти объект в системе по его номеру.
Зайти в редактирование и убедиться, что параметр заполнен.

Какой параметр должен быть заполнен можно посмотреть по ссылке - Выгрузка - Список площадок -Параметры выгрузки -  /admin/feed/feed_config
Если параметр не заполнен - написать клиенту, чтобы заполнили данный параметр в редактировании объекта, и сообщить, что со следующим обновлением фида, данный тег и заполненное значение в параметре будет присутствовать в фиде.

 

2. Если параметр заполнен, нужно проверить его наличие в фиде.

 

  • в просмотре объекта для облегчения поиска, зайти на вкладку Выгрузка. Напротив необходимой площадки ищем ссылку на валидацию, что она делает - она открывает информацию по конкретному объекту в файле фида.

Если есть ошибки и подключены отчеты по выгрузке -  они подсвечиваются красным и вверху есть ссылка на требования площадки

 

Ищем параметр.

Если вы обнаружили искомый тег в фиде - следует отправить ссылку на фид и скриншот с поиском клиенту, чтобы клиент отправил запрос с нашей информацией в ТП площадки.

Если вы не обнаружили искомый тег в фиде, но он при этом заполнен в объекте, нужно обновить фиды  принудительно, нажав на кнопку Обновить объекты на RLTBASE в разделе Агентство-Интернет платформы.
Еще раз посмотреть после 10 минут ожидания и проверить наличие в фиде, при этом надо убедиться, что фиды обновились по времени. 

 

3. Если вышеперечисленные пункты не помогли, и заполненного параметра в объекте  с соответствующим тегом, вы так и не нашли в фиде, нужно проследовать дальше: 

3.1. Нужно зайти на страницу Параметры выгрузки, найти название параметра который мы ищем, посмотреть какой алиас (название)  у искомого параметра, если мы ищем WallsType, то алиас параметра  категории в объекте должен соответствовать названию параметра на странице параметров выгрузке.
То есть, если в параметрах выгрузки указано название WallsType, а в алисе параметра объекта категории Квартира указан Material - то параметр не будет выгружаться. Так как не соответствует требованиям площадки.
3.2. Чтобы выгрузка работала корректно - нужно привести в соответствие названий алиасов параметра объекта и параметра выгрузки
Для проверки названий также всегда нужно обращаться  требованиям площадки.

Если выгрузка после всех действий в вышеперечисленных пунктов не принесла успеха, нужно поставить баг.

 

4. Бывают запросы, что тег выгружается, но с неверным значением.
Например, тег WallsType, нужно чтобы выгружался Кирпичный, а выгружается Кирпично-монолитный.

В этом случае, нам нужно зайти в словарь искомого параметра категории и посмотреть, какие значения проставлены в столбце feed

Все верные значения для словаря, всегда находятся в разделе Параметры выгрузки.

Также нужно сравнить алиас словаря и значения словаря - то есть сделать такую же подробную проверку как  в пункте 3.

 

5. Не создавать параметры самим с теми алиасами как вам или клиенту хочется.
Есть специальная страница   для проверки АЛИАСА параметра выгрузки.

Также, если в проекте есть правильно созданный параметр, нажатие на кнопку Создать параметр ни к чему не приведет.
Если нет параметра в проекте - его нужно создать, через кнопку Создать в параметрах выгрузки.


 

Если в фиде не выгружается номер телефона, заявленный клиентом

  1. Нужно уточнить у клиента  номер объекта и какой должен выгружаться номер телефона.

  2. Далее нужно проверить по порядку следующую информацию:

  • проставлен ли единый номер у площадки. Если номер телефона проставлен - по умолчанию он проставляется только в НОВЫХ ДОБАВЛЯЕМЫХ на выгрузку объектов. Чтобы проставить единый номер площадки всем объектам нужно запустить команду  /admin/feed/feed_objects/set_default_phone/7, где 7 это номер нужной нам интернет-платформы 

  • если единый номер не проставлен, идем в редактирование объекта и смотрим что заполнено в поле Телефон для выгрузки.

  • если перечисленные выше поля не заполнены, то по умолчанию, выгружается номер телефона ответственного за объект пользователя. 

 

Регламент постановки бага по выгрузке (если не выгружается параметр)


 

  1. Ссылка на заявку, ссылка на проект, ссылка на объект, ссылка на фид.

  2. Ссылка на параметр категории в системе, ссылка на параметр выгрузки

  3. ссылка на валидацию объекта

  4. Название невыгружаемого тега, ссылка на требования площадки

  5. Как должен выгружаться параметр (тег и значение тега)

  6. Описание всех вышеперечисленных пунктов - что было, что сделано, что ожидаете по итогу решения задачи.